How much is street parking in Winnipeg?

The Winnipeg Parking Authority provides paid on-street parking in the downtown and Exchange District areas of Winnipeg. The majority of paystations in these areas allow for two hours of parking at a cost of $1.75 per hour in low demand areas.

Is there free street parking in Winnipeg?

Payment is required for on-street parking during designated hours in the Downtown, Exchange District, West End, and in some areas surrounding hospitals. Paid parking is generally in effect from Monday to Friday, between 8 a.m. and 5:30 p.m. However, these hours may vary so pay close attention to signage.

Is there one hour free parking downtown Winnipeg?

The city has announced that free one-hour parking at all metered locations in Winnipeg from Monday to Friday will be ending on December 31, 2021. Temporary 15-minute loading zones around Downtown and the Exchange District will also be ending on December 31, 2021.

Is parking free on Sunday in Winnipeg?

Monday – Saturday: Free from 5:30 p.m. – 8 a.m. Saturday: 2 hours free. Sundays & statuatory holidays: Free all day.

How many vehicles can you have on your property in Winnipeg?

6 vehicles
If more than a maximum of 6 vehicles are parked on a driveway and are reported a City of Winnipeg By-Law Enforcement Officers will may come to the house and issue a fine. Please respect the neighbourhood zoning by-laws and do not park more than 6 vehicles on your property.

What does parking 2 hours no return within 1 hour mean?

‘Two hours – no return within one hour’ – This means you can park in the spot for up to two hours, but you can’t return and park there again within one hour. ‘One hour – no return within two hours’ – You can park there for one hour but can’t return and park in the same spot again within two hours.
